Feature Comparison

Antwork

Brand DNA Learning Engine

Antwork's foundational technology is its ability to learn and internalize your brand's unique identity. By scanning your website and analyzing your existing social media content and performance data, it builds a dynamic profile of your voice, tone, style, and key terminology. This isn't a static setup; the AI continuously learns and refines its understanding from every post and interaction, ensuring your content remains authentic and evolves with your brand.

Conversational AI Agent

Interact with Antwork through a simple chat interface. This AI agent has full context of your brand DNA. You can ask it to draft posts, plan a content calendar, research trending topics, generate on-brand images, or analyze post performance—all through natural conversation. It transforms complex social media tasks into simple, plain-language requests, making advanced content strategy accessible to everyone.

Cross-Platform Adaptive Publishing

Write a post once and publish it everywhere. Antwork intelligently adapts your core message for the specific format, tone, and best practices of each platform, including LinkedIn, X, Instagram, Facebook, YouTube, TikTok, Threads, and Pinterest. This ensures your content is optimized for engagement on every channel without requiring manual rewrites, saving immense time and effort.

Multi-Brand Team Workspaces

Built for agencies and organizations managing multiple clients or brands, this feature allows you to create separate, secure workspaces for each entity. Each workspace maintains its own distinct Brand DNA, social accounts, and content calendar. You can invite team members with role-based permissions and implement client approval workflows, streamlining collaboration and scaling your operations efficiently.

WeekHack

Weekly Launch Visibility

Every product submitted to WeekHack enjoys an entire week of visibility, ensuring that creators can engage with their audience and gather valuable feedback without the fear of being overshadowed by newer launches.

Community Voting System

The platform features a community-driven voting mechanism that empowers users to support their favorite products. This democratic approach not only enhances engagement but also helps highlight the most innovative projects.

The top three projects each week receive winner badges, which not only acknowledge their success but also come with dofollow backlinks from a high-domain authority website, providing real and measurable SEO advantages.

Premium Launch Options

For creators looking for additional visibility, WeekHack offers a premium submission option. For a nominal fee, users can select their launch week and secure featured placement, ensuring their product stands out in a crowded marketplace.

Frequently Asked Questions

Antwork FAQ

How does Antwork learn my brand voice?

Antwork analyzes the content from your connected sources, such as your website and existing social media profiles. It examines your writing style, frequently used terminology, tone, and the performance of your past posts. This data trains its AI to understand and replicate your unique brand identity, creating a dynamic "Brand DNA" that improves over time.

Which social media platforms does Antwork support?

Antwork supports publishing and scheduling to LinkedIn, X (formerly Twitter), Instagram, Facebook, YouTube, TikTok, Threads, and Pinterest. This covers all major platforms, allowing you to manage your entire social presence from one centralized dashboard with platform-specific adaptations.

What are AI credits and how are they used?

AI credits are consumed when Antwork's AI generates content for you. Roughly one credit equals one AI-generated social media post draft. Credits are also used for AI image generation and web research tasks. Pricing plans include a monthly allowance of credits, ensuring you only pay for the level of AI assistance you actually use.

Can I manage multiple brands or clients with Antwork?

Yes, Antwork offers multi-brand workspaces, which are essential for agencies and businesses managing several brands. You can create separate workspaces for each client or brand, each with its own unique Brand DNA, social accounts, team members, and approval workflows, all within a single Antwork account.

WeekHack FAQ

How does the voting system work?

The voting system allows community members to vote for their favorite products throughout the week. The projects with the most votes at the end of the week are recognized as winners.

Can I submit my product for free?

Yes, WeekHack allows users to submit their products for free. However, there is also a premium option available for those who want additional visibility and control over their launch timing.

What benefits do winner badges provide?

Winner badges signify that a product has been well-received by the community. They come with dofollow backlinks from a high-authority domain, which can enhance SEO and drive more traffic to the product's website.

Is there a limit to how many products I can submit?

There is no limit on the number of products you can submit to WeekHack. However, to maximize visibility and engagement, it is advisable to focus on quality submissions rather than quantity.
